Partial street closure downtown on Monday

MEDICINE HAT, AB – Traffic around a well-travelled downtown block will be restricted for six hours on Monday morning.

The 200 block of Sixth Avenue SE downtown – between Second Street and Third Street – will be down to single-lane traffic in both directions between 6 a.m. and noon for sewer lining.

The City of Medicine Hat adds portion of the intersection at Sixth Avenue and Second Street will be closed to access the manhole, thereby restricting westbound traffic on Second Street into the right-hand lane through the intersection. This includes traffic turning left (west) from Sixth Avenue onto Second Street.

The city says existing concrete sewer infrastructure has experienced degradation from high sulphate levels. Repairing it requires draining and cleaning the existing pipe, inserting an epoxy liner through the sewer system between two manholes, and then curing it in place with steam. The technology allows full restoration of the sewer trunk without having to excavate and expose the piping.

Water and sewer services in the area will remain operational and pedestrian traffic will not be affected.

Motorists are asked to plan routes in advance and to follow signage and speed reductions to ensure the safety of workers and the public.
